Apoorva Mukhija Reveals Suicidal Thoughts During India's Got Latent Row

Mental Health Struggles Revealed:

Content creator Apoorva Mukhija has opened up about severe mental health struggles following the intense public controversy surrounding Samay Raina's show India's Got Latent. Mukhija revealed that she experienced suicidal ideation during the peak of the backlash and online harassment. She credited fellow personality Sufi Motiwala with stepping in and saving her life during the darkest phase of the ordeal.

The India's Got Latent Controversy:

The backlash erupted after episodes of the digital comedy show drew widespread public scrutiny and fierce online debate regarding acceptable boundaries of humour. Participants and guests associated with the show faced aggressive trolling across social media platforms. Mukhija found herself at the centre of this digital storm, which rapidly escalated into severe personal distress.

Wider Industry Reactions:

The disclosure has sparked renewed conversations across Indian entertainment circles regarding the psychological toll of cyberbullying and online vitriol directed at digital creators. Supporters and fellow influencers have rallied behind Mukhija, highlighting the urgent need for robust mental health support systems within the digital creator economy. Public figures continue to debate accountability for online hate mobs that target independent creators.
